数据库怎么上传到云服务器中,详细解析,如何将数据库成功上传至云服务器
- 综合资讯
- 2024-11-12 07:16:10
- 2

将数据库上传至云服务器,首先需在本地数据库中导出数据,然后通过FTP、SFTP或SCP等方式传输至服务器。接着在云服务器上安装数据库软件,创建数据库和用户,最后将数据导...
将数据库上传至云服务器,首先需在本地数据库中导出数据,然后通过FTP、SFTP或SCP等方式传输至服务器。接着在云服务器上安装数据库软件,创建数据库和用户,最后将数据导入服务器数据库。具体操作包括:导出数据、配置传输工具、服务器安装数据库、创建数据库和用户、导入数据等步骤。
随着云计算技术的飞速发展,越来越多的企业和个人选择将数据库迁移到云服务器中,以提高数据存储和处理的效率,本文将详细介绍如何将数据库上传到云服务器,旨在帮助您顺利完成这一过程。
准备工作
1、确定云服务器提供商
您需要选择一家合适的云服务器提供商,目前市面上知名的云服务器提供商有阿里云、腾讯云、华为云等,在选择提供商时,请综合考虑价格、性能、服务等因素。
2、创建云服务器实例
在云服务器提供商的控制台中,创建一个新的云服务器实例,请确保选择合适的实例规格,以满足数据库存储和处理的需求。
3、获取云服务器ip地址和密码
创建实例后,您将获得云服务器的IP地址和密码,请妥善保管这些信息,以便后续操作。
数据库备份
在将数据库上传到云服务器之前,您需要先对数据库进行备份,以下是常见的数据库备份方法:
1、MySQL数据库备份
(1)使用mysqldump
命令备份:
mysqldump -u 用户名 -p 数据库名 > 备份文件.sql
(2)将备份文件上传到本地或云存储服务。
2、SQL Server数据库备份
(1)使用BACKUP DATABASE
命令备份:
BACKUP DATABASE 数据库名 TO DISK = '备份文件.bak'
(2)将备份文件上传到本地或云存储服务。
3、Oracle数据库备份
(1)使用RMAN
命令备份:
RMAN BACKUP DATABASE AS BACKUPSET
(2)将备份文件上传到本地或云存储服务。
上传数据库备份文件
1、使用FTP、SFTP或SCP等工具上传备份文件到云服务器。
2、使用命令行工具,如scp
:
scp 本地备份文件 云服务器用户@云服务器IP地址:/指定路径/
在云服务器上还原数据库
1、登录云服务器。
2、将备份文件从上传路径移动到数据库存储路径。
3、根据数据库类型,使用相应的还原命令:
(1)MySQL数据库还原:
mysql -u 用户名 -p 数据库名 < 备份文件.sql
(2)SQL Server数据库还原:
RESTORE DATABASE 数据库名 FROM DISK = '备份文件.bak' WITH NORECOVERY
(3)Oracle数据库还原:
RMAN RESTORE DATABASE
验证数据库
1、使用数据库客户端连接到云服务器上的数据库。
2、执行一些SQL查询,以验证数据库是否成功还原。
优化数据库性能
1、根据实际情况,调整数据库配置参数,如内存、连接数等。
2、对数据库进行索引优化,提高查询效率。
3、定期进行数据库备份和恢复演练,确保数据安全。
将数据库上传到云服务器是一个相对复杂的过程,但只要按照上述步骤进行,您就可以顺利完成这一任务,在操作过程中,请注意以下几点:
1、确保备份文件完整且无损坏。
2、在上传和还原数据库时,确保网络稳定。
3、定期对数据库进行维护和优化,以提高性能。
希望本文对您有所帮助,祝您成功将数据库上传到云服务器!
本文链接:https://zhitaoyun.cn/773708.html
发表评论